The time is right for this comprehensive, state-of-the-art Handbook that analyzes, integrates, and summarizes theoretical advances and research findings on adult development and learning - a rapidly growing field reflecting demographic shifts toward an aging population in Western societies. Featuring contributions from prominent scholars across diverse disciplinary fields (education, developmental psychology, public policy, gerontology, neurology, public health, sociology, family studies, and adult education), the volume is organized around six themes:
-
- theoretical perspectives on adult development and learning
-
- research methods in adult development
-
- research on adult development
-
- research on adult learning
-
- aging and gerontological research
-
- policy perspectives on aging.
The Handbook is an essential reference for researchers, faculty, graduate students and practitioners whose work pertains to adult and lifespan development and learning.
M Cecil Smith is Professor, Department of Leadership, Educational Psychology and Foundations, Northern Illinois University.
Nancy DeFrates-Densch is an Instructor in the Educational Psychology program, Department of Leadership, Educational Psychology and Foundations, Northern Illinois University.
